What is Bitcoin Cash (BCH)?
Bitcoin Cash (BCH) is a decentralized cryptocurrency that was created as a result of a hard fork from Bitcoin (BTC) in 2017. The primary goal of Bitcoin Cash was to increase the block size limit, allowing for faster and cheaper transactions. This makes BCH an attractive option for those looking to avoid the high transaction fees and slow confirmation times associated with Bitcoin.

How to Exchange Bitcoin Cash to VND
1. Choose a Reliable Exchange Platform
The first step in exchanging Bitcoin Cash to VND is to select a reliable and secure exchange platform. Some popular options include Binance, Kraken, and Bitfinex. Ensure that the platform supports both Bitcoin Cash and Vietnamese Dong, and has a good reputation in the cryptocurrency community.
2. Create an Account and Verify Your Identity
Once you have chosen an exchange platform, create an account and complete the necessary verification process. This typically involves providing your full name, date of birth, and proof of identity. Verification is essential to comply with anti-money laundering (AML) and know your customer (KYC) regulations.
3. Deposit Bitcoin Cash
After verifying your account, deposit Bitcoin Cash into your exchange wallet. You can do this by sending BCH from your external wallet or by purchasing it directly from the exchange. Ensure that you have enough BCH to cover the desired exchange amount.
4. Exchange Bitcoin Cash to VND
Once your BCH is in your exchange wallet, navigate to the trading section and select the Bitcoin Cash to Vietnamese Dong pair. Enter the desired amount of BCH you wish to exchange and click on "exchange." The platform will then display the estimated VND amount you will receive.
5. Withdraw Your VND
After the exchange is complete, you can withdraw your VND to your bank account or use it for local transactions. Ensure that you have the necessary bank details ready to facilitate the withdrawal process.
